15 November: ALEX SHNAIDER, OWNER OF MIDLAND'S F1 TEAM, OFFICIALLY RECEIVES RUSSIAN RACING LICENSE FROM VICTOR KIRYANOV, PRESIDENT OF THE RUSSIAN AUTOMOBILE FEDERATION

Victor Kiryanov, President of the Russian Automobile Federation (RAF), today presented Midland Group Chairman and MF1 Racing team founder Alex Shnaider with an official license for the team’s entry into the 2006 Formula One World Championship. Having acquired a license from the RAF, MF1 Racing now becomes the first team to compete under the Russian flag in the world's most prestigious motor racing series.

International Automobile Federation (FIA) rules state that in order to participate in the F1 World Championship, a team should make an entry application with a license issued by a national motorsports authority attached to it.

At the team launch in Moscow’s Red Square in February 2005, Mr. Shnaider announced that the new team, created on the basis of the Jordan Grand Prix team acquired by Midland Group, would bring Russian style and technical know-how to the world of Formula One.

Alex Shnaider, Midland Group Chairman, MF1 Racing Founder stated: “As a Russian-born person, I am extremely pleased that the team founded by Midland Group will compete in the Formula One World Championship with a Russian identity. It has always been Midland's intention to enter F1 with a Russian license – an association which reflects this project's core targets and values – and I am very grateful to the RAF and Victor Kiryanov, President of the Federation, for their support. I believe that Midland Group's decision to enter its team under the Russian flag will push forward the development of Russia's motorsport and open new horizons for Russian racing drivers at the international level. MF1 Racing will make every effort toward achieving this goal and welcomes collaboration with the Russian authorities and Russian businesses in this challenging and extremely important undertaking.”

Victor Kiryanov, President of the Russian Automobile Federation, commented: “Russian motor sport needs support from big business to develop and I am very happy that, thanks to Midland Group, our country will gain entry to the most important racing series on the planet. Getting a Russian team into F1 is a crucial step forward, both for Russian motorsport and for a nation that wishes to be seen as increasingly progressive in the modern world. Acquiring the Russian license marks the first step of a long journey for the Russian motor sport and for our country toward reaching the highest levels of international motorsport. I hope that some day, thanks to our joint efforts, Russian drivers will be racing and excelling in Formula One.”

Bernie Ecclestone, Formula One Management President, said: “I am very happy that we now have in Formula One a team with a Russian license. I am sure the MF1 Racing team will create interest not only in Russia but also worldwide. I wish Alex Shnaider and the team the best of luck and the support of a great nation.”
